Soldering BAL-NRF01D3

Hello,

is there any guidance on how to solder the balun?

As it "sinks" while soldering, and I'm not sure if it is a "normal state".

Thank you Oleh

Parents
  • That would be normal for a BGA/WLCSP device, the balls will collapse when soldered. For prototypes I would just put flux on the pads rather than using solder paste as it's easy to get shorts when using solder paste for small pitch BGA devices. Also, use ENIG surface PCBs rather than HASL, the uneven surface level with HASL can make the soldering very unreliable.
